Callpod Dragon V2

PCWorld Rating

2.5
2.5 / 5 - PCWorld, Dec 22, 2008

Pros

  • Unique design
  • Ear-wear extras, car charger, carrying pouch

Cons

  • Poor sound quality overall
  • Heavy

Bottom Line

I found the Dragon V2's sound quality disappointing, and its advertised working range of 300-plus feet does not hold up.
